Crafted Precision

Hunter series rifles use an RPA 3 shot ‘drop box’ magazine and are available in a range of calibres. The GP hunter is available in a left or right handed configuration. The TH Hunter is only available in right hand configuration. All RPA triggers have a 2 stage mechanism, with a positive first stage and crisp release it is also equipped with a 2-position safety catch.

RPA uses match grade stainless steel barrels from quality manufacturers with a proven record of performance. Barrels are fluted as standard which improves the balance of the rifle and enhances cooling. The barrel muzzle is threaded 17mm x 1mm to allow for the easy fitting of a muzzle brake or suppressor.

Hunter series rifle stocks are designed for rough handling, poor weather conditions and are crafted from an epoxy with glass and Kevlar reinforcement, finished with a durable epoxy gel-coat outer layer before final textured 2 part paint finish.
Standard colour is black, other colours to special order. The Hunter series rifles have a fixed butt plate with spacers as standard. All exposed aluminium parts are anodised for durability and protection against the elements.

Safety & Engineering

The heart of any rifle is the receiver, developed from the Quadlock® and designed with the gun connoisseur in mind; the Quadlite® is designed for long range competition, sporting, varmint and bench shooters alike. Built using over 30 years experience of high power long range competition target shooting the Quadlite® has a first class pedigree.

Benefits

  • One piece bolt incorporating a cocked ‘tell tale’.
  • Passive ejector for reliable operation.
  • Drilled to accept scope rails.
  • Short firing pin travel provides for very fast lock time (less than 1.5 milliseconds).
  • Firing pin is a single piece of high tensile steel hardened and tempered.
  • Heavy duty recoil plate has locator spigot to allow barrel removal and re-fitting without compromising the position of the plate to the bedding.
  • Modern shape and materials, finished in satin black, high wear and corrosion resistant finish.
  • High tensile steels and solid construction make it the safest rifle available.
  • RPA triggers used in the Hunter series have: Adjustable finger pull. A nominal pull weight of 0.5 Kg. Hardened and burnished pivots to reduce friction. Positive first stage. Smooth operation. All models have a two position safety catch.
